Is Sleepy Hollow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Sleepy Hollow in Orinda, CA has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 9, which is 91% below the national average of 100. Sleepy Hollow is safer than 97% of neighborhoods in Orinda.
Compared to the Orinda average (crime index 38), Sleepy Hollow is 29% lower in overall crime.
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 37, 63% below average), while burglary is the lowest risk (index: 6).

What are the demographics of Sleepy Hollow?
Sleepy Hollow has a population of approximately 714. The median household income is $238,316. The median home value is $2,217,917. Research shows that economic factors can correlate with crime rates, though many other variables play a role in neighborhood safety.
